var hideTimer = null;
var hideStamp = 500;

function showMenu( id, base )
{
    menuClearHideTimer();
    
  //  alert(id + ' ' + base);
    
   menuHideAll();

   var el = document.getElementById('menu_'+ id);
   el.style.display = 'block';
  //  el.style.left = $ol( base ) - 150 + "px";
  //  el.style.top = ( $ot( base ) + parseInt( base.offsetHeight ) -50 ) + "px";

};


function hideMenu( id )
{
    hideTimer = setTimeout( "hideMenuEx("+ id +");", hideStamp );
};


function hideMenuEx( id )
{
    var el = document.getElementById('menu_'+ id);
    el.style.display = 'none';
};


function menuClearHideTimer()
{
    try{ clearTimeout( hideTimer ); }catch(e){}
};


function menuHideAll()
{
    var i = 1;
    while( document.getElementById('menu_'+ i) != null )
    {
        hideMenuEx( i ); i++;
    }
};